Key Mechanisms and Herb Categories

Effective calming herbs target root causes—nervine tonics relax acutely, adaptogens build resilience, aromatics shift mood fast.

Nervine Relaxants for Acute Calm

Best herbs for anxiety, like chamomile and passionflower, bind GABA receptors, mimicking benzodiazepines gently. Chamomile's apigenin crosses the blood-brain barrier, easing tension headaches from screen marathons. Passionflower excels for rumination—studies show it rivals drugs for GAD relief.

Desi valerian root (tagar) sedates deeply, perfect pre-sleep for entrepreneurs winding down Redbubble edits.

Adaptogens for Long-Term Resilience

Ashwagandha, rhodiola, holy basil (tulsi) normalize stress responses—lowering cortisol when high, energizing when low. Ashwagandha's withanolides shield neurons; tulsi's eugenol balances thyroid, curbing fatigue masquerading as stress.

Adaptogens for stress shine in sustained pressure: Rhodiola prevents mental fatigue during fantasy cricket binges.

Aromatic and Digestive Soothers

Lemon balm uplifts mood via rosmarinic acid; peppermint clears mental fog through menthol's cooling. Fennel and ginger settle gut-brain axis butterflies, where 90% serotonin resides.

Pitfalls That Block Herb Effectiveness

Overdosing backfires—ashwagandha excess sedates; start with half doses. Ignoring quality: stale herbs lose potency—buy whole, grind fresh.

Pairing wrong: sedatives with alcohol amplify; stimulants like ginseng midday crash evenings.

Expecting instant fixes: adaptogens build over 2-4 weeks. Gut issues block uptake—probiotics first.

Pregnancy caution: some like licorice are contraindicated—consult always.
